Is travel possible whilst awaiting passport application?

Post by catchetat » Mon May 24, 2021 7:23 pm

I hold a foreign nationality passport with Tier 2. I attended naturalisation citizenship last week. I am due to travel abroad late next month. Can I travel abroad with my current passport following UK Passport application or will I have to wait?

If I have to wait, are there any temporary documents I can apply so I can travel?

Re: Is travel possible whilst awaiting passport application?

Post by CR001 » Mon May 24, 2021 7:28 pm

You have to submit all your uncancelled original passport(s) with your British passport application.

There is no temparoy document unfortunately.
